Kodihal
Kodihal is a village located in Hungund taluka of Bagalkot district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 34km away from sub-district headquarter Hungund (tehsildar office) and 84km away from district headquarter Bagalkot. As per 2009 stats, Nandwadgi is the gram panchayat of Kodihal village.

About Kodihal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kodihal is 598966. The village spans a total geographical area of 1298.47 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 587125. Hungund is nearest town to Kodihal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 34km away.

Population of Kodihal
Below is a concise population overview of Kodihal as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,723 | 1,303 | 1,420 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 309 | 148 | 161 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 289 | 135 | 154 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 97 | 49 | 48 |
Literate Population | 1,722 | 1,000 | 722 |
Illiterate Population | 1,001 | 303 | 698 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kodihal village:
- The total population of Kodihal village is around 2,723, including approximately 1,303 males and 1,420 females, with a sex ratio of 1089 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 309 children aged 0–6 years in Kodihal village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kodihal village has 289 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 97 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kodihal village is about 63.24%, with male literacy at 76.75% and female literacy at 50.85%.
- There are around 586 households in Kodihal village.
Connectivity of Kodihal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kodihal. As per the 2011 stats, Kodihal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
